Quoter is a robust quoting software designed to simplify the estimation and proposal process for businesses across various industries. This platform allows users to create accurate and professional quotes quickly, ensuring that clients receive timely and well-structured estimates. Merkato is a dynamic proposal management software designed to streamline the creation, tracking, and approval of business proposals. With Merkato, teams can collaborate effectively by utilizing customizable templates, allowing users to create professional proposals that reflect their brand identity.
